We take disc golf gear seriously. And if You take disc golf seriously, this is the bag for you. The DG Luxury Backpack is made to carry approximately 20 discs, but it can carry 30 if all compartments are used for discs. We have placed the putter pocket and water bottle pocket holder on each side for easy access. Thanks to the unique front pocket the bag does not tip forward as easy as other backpacks. The clever umbrella holder enables you to carry the bag with the umbrella open. It has a lot of extra pockets and compartments to store your gear. Towels, water bottle, scorecard, pens, keys, phone, wallet, rain gear, umbrella, snacks, mini disc and extra clothes fits without a problem. To summon it up: We got your back!
Features:
Weight: 2.8 kg (6.1 lbs)
Dimensions: 51cm x 40cm x 27cm (20” x 16” x 10”)
Fabric: 600Dx600D Poly ripstop with Eco Friendly PVC backing.
Discs and water bottle are NOT included.
*Rain cover is sold separately.

When it was advertised as "stable" I was expecting a meat hook with huge fade. I like the Trust and figured this was a step beyond. Turns out to not be the case. Where the Trust goes straight, the Savior has a nice forward push and glide with a gentle, yet firm, fade at the end. The thicker shoulder also means easier forehand release and better torque resistance than the Trust. Definitely room for both in the bag.
